What You Require to Recognize Following an 18-Wheeler Collision

What should one take action immediately following an 18-wheeler crash? The primary concern is guaranteeing safety. Individuals involved should check for injuries and, if able, relocate to a safe location distant from vehicles. Contacting first responders is critical to report the crash and receive medical assistance. Gathering evidence is also vital; individuals should take photographs of the location, vehicle damage, and any apparent wounds. Collecting details from witnesses can strengthen subsequent legal action.

Next, it is vital to exchange details with the truck driver, including insurance details and truck registration numbers. Refrain from discussing fault or providing statements that could be construed as admissions of liability. Documenting everything meticulously can help in future proceedings. Finally, seeking medical attention, even if injuries seem minor, can guarantee proper treatment and documentation. This first action sets the groundwork for any subsequent legal and insurance processes.

Compiling Information: Critical Steps to Fortify Your Case

Assembling evidence is critical for developing a compelling case after an 18-wheeler accident. This procedure commences with obtaining police reports, which offer official documentation of the incident, including details about the accident's cause and involved parties. Eyewitness statements can also be extremely valuable, offering firsthand accounts that may validate the victim's version of events.

Photographic evidence should be obtained, documenting the scene, damage to vehicles, and relevant driving conditions. Furthermore, it is crucial to obtain any existing video evidence from nearby security cameras or traffic monitoring systems, as this can provide unbiased information into the incident.

Medical documentation documenting harm sustained during the accident are essential for determining the extent of damages. Finally, reviewing the trucking company's upkeep records and driver logs can reveal possible negligence or violations. Each piece of evidence adds to a comprehensive understanding of the case, greatly enhancing the probability of a favorable outcome.

Kinds Of Potential Damages

Tackling the complexities of an 18-wheeler accident situation demands a thorough awareness of the range of potential damages that victims can claim. Victims have the right to seek damage awards, which cover treatment costs, salary loss, and property damage. Concurrently, trauma and pain damages may be claimed, reflecting the psychological and physical injury from the accident. Under certain circumstances, punitive awards could also be applicable, aimed at punish the guilty party for egregious behavior, like unsafe driving or gross negligence. Moreover, victims are empowered to seek compensation for diminished lifestyle, particularly if their capacity to enjoy routine activities has been considerably impaired. Grasping these categories is fundamental for victims to competently handle their available legal pathways.

Often Asked Questions

What is the Average Cost of Hiring an 18-Wheeler Accident Legal Representative?

Engaging an heavy truck crash attorney usually demands between 25% to 40% of the award, contingent on the case's complexity. Many lawyers take cases with contingency fees, asking for no upfront payment.

How Much Time Does It Typically Take to Settle an 18-Wheeler Collision Case?

The usual duration for handling an 18-wheeler collision case extends from multiple months to a few years. Components impacting this length consist of complex investigations, talks, and potential court cases, often lengthening the overall process.

What if the Truck Driver Was Uninsured or Inadequately Insured?

If the truck driver lacked adequate coverage, pursuing damages might prove challenging. Victims could look into alternatives such as their own insurance policies, underinsured motorist protection, or submitting a claim against the trucking company, if relevant.
